Arnold lies sprawled across the Nebraska prairie, a place where the sky feels impossibly vast, stretching its blue canvas from horizon to horizon. It lies 76.5 miles north-west of Kearney, NE (from Kearney, NE: bearing 311°T), and is situated 16.7 miles west-north-west of Callaway. Rolling hills, softened by the endless work of wind and sun, give way to wide, flat expanses that invite the eye to wander. The air here carries the scent of dry grasses and distant rain, a clean, sharp perfume that speaks of open country. In the late afternoon, the light takes on a honeyed quality, bathing the few scattered buildings and the surrounding farmland in a warm, golden glow that seems to hold the day's memories. It's a landscape that feels both enduring and ephemeral, shaped by forces far larger than human hands, yet intimately familiar to those who call it home. The history of Arnold is etched into the very soil, a testament to the grit and determination of early settlers who sought their fortunes on this fertile ground. Primarily an agricultural hub, the local economy has long been sustained by the bounty of the land, with crops like corn and soybeans painting the fields in broad strokes of green and gold. Ranching also plays a vital role, the quiet hum of machinery on a distant farm or the faint lowing of cattle carried on the breeze a constant reminder of this enduring heritage. While Arnold may not boast grand monuments, its character is found in the steadfastness of its people and the quiet dignity of a life lived in harmony with the seasons, a rhythm dictated by the sun and the soil.
